Nor'wester likely to hit six divisions

Temperature level could fall up to 3 degrees Celsius

Nor'wester or Kalbaisakhi storm might hit six divisions of the country and it could lower the temperature by up to 3 degrees Celsius, according to the Bangladesh Meteorological Department (BMD) forecast on Monday.

Meteorologist Omar Faruq said a major portion of the low-pressure system stretches from the country's southwest region to the northwest of the Bay of Bengal.

The recent weather reports suggest the daytime temperature across the country may experience a decline of up to 3 degrees Celsius. However, there could be a slight increase in the nighttime temperature.

Residents in Rajshahi, Dhaka, Khulna, and Barishal divisions should brace for temporary gusty winds accompanied by rain, Met office said.

It said scattered hailstorms and thunderstorms may occur in certain areas of Rangpur, Mymensingh, Chittagong, and Sylhet divisions from Tuesday morning to Wednesday morning.

Met office advised people to stay updated on the weather and take necessary precautions to ensure safety.

The forecast indicates a persistent chance of rainfall and thunderstorms over the next five days.
